Nikon D 100 question
 
Yes, I know my D 100 is a dino but I do like it and it performs well. The biggest CF card I have been using for a while now is 256mb. I can't seem to find an answer on whether I can use a 4GB card ...or larger..or not. I do have the latest firmware installed. The Nikon web site is not up to date on this as they say the largest is 64mb if you can imagine that.

Anyone out there know about this ?

slodave 04-19-2009 11:47 AM

Here's what I found...

My 2 gig gives me:

RAW - 205
TIFF - 112
JPG fine - 606
norm - 1.1k
basic - 2.2k

The 4 gig:
RAW - 410
TIFF - 225
JPG fine - 1.2k
norm - 2.3k
basic - 4.5k

The 8 gig:
RAW - 390
TIFF - 214
JPG fine - 1.1k
norm - 2.2k
basic - 4.3k

I am going to guess that 4 gig is as big as you a go. BTW, don't bother buying UDMA CF cards, as the D100 does not support UDMA, although the cards will work. They cost more.
